Ingredients

  • 2 ¾cupsall-purpose flour

  • 1teaspoonbaking soda

  • ½teaspoonbaking powder

  • ½cupbutter, softened

  • ¼cupnonfat plain yogurt

  • 1 ½cupswhite sugar

  • 1egg

  • 1teaspoonvanilla extract

Cooking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Stir flour, baking soda, and baking powder in a small bowl.

  2. Beat butter, yogurt, and sugar with an electric mixer in a large bowl until smooth. Add egg allowing it to blend into butter mixture. Beat in vanilla extract. Mix in flour mixture until just incorporated. Roll dough into walnut-sized balls and place 2-inches apart onto ungreased baking sheets.

  3. Bake in preheated oven until golden, 8 to 10 minutes. Let stand on baking sheet two minutes before removing to cool on wire racks.

Editor’s Note:

This recipe is a healthier version of Easy Sugar Cookies.
